National Center for Atmospheric Research | Electrical Engineer | Boulder, CO | On Site + Visa | Full Time

At NCAR we study weather, water, climate, air quality, and space weather to help protect lives and livelihoods, grow the economy, and enhance our nation’s security and well-being. The In-Situ Sensing Facility (ISF) provides measurements made directly in the environment as well as profiling measurements of the lower atmosphere. Measurements are made in-situ at the earth's surface, on towers, on balloons, and on packages dropped from aircraft.

We’re looking for an electrical engineer to develop and test existing and new in-situ atmospheric instrumentation. The position is also responsible for operating and supporting scientific instrumentation in the field, and leading field programs when appropriate.

Packetized Energy | Software Engineer, Senior Software Engineer | Full time | ONSITE | Boston, MA or Burlington, VT

Packetized Energy builds batteries: giant, distributed, energy storage systems--Virtual Batteries--made up of everyday things like home heating and cooling systems, water heaters and residential electric vehicle chargers. A clean energy future needs energy storage systems of this size and ours are the most flexible, scalable, and privacy-focused distributed energy resource management systems around. Come help us make a clean energy future possible.

Packetized Energy grew out of DOE- and NSF-funded research into grid flexibility and resilience at the University of Vermont. We're a small team but we're growing fast. We're currently hiring Mid- to Senior-level Software Engineers in the Boston and Burlington, VT areas to help us scale our cloud systems and build new products on top of our existing core technology.

MD.ai | Software Engineer | Full-time | New York, NY / Seattle, WA | Onsite OR Remote (USA only)

We are a medical AI development platform (https://www.md.ai), currently focused on radiology/pathology/dermatology. We help build high-quality labeled datasets for both training and clinical validation, as well as provide tools and infrastructure for deploying and running models at scale. Some of our unique challenges include: operating in HIPAA-compliant environments, working with large medical imaging/text/genomic datasets, managing machine learning model lifecycles, and building complex web applications with UI/UX appealing to both doctors and engineers alike.

We are currently looking for front-end developers (React, GraphQL) and software engineers experienced in devops/cloud technologies (Kubernetes, Docker, Terraform, GCP/AWS/Azure).
